How to Get the Wrex Family Armor Quest
To get the Wrex family armor quest, you must first recruit Urdnot Wrex and then repeatedly talk to him about his past in the Normandy’s Cargo Bay, eventually unlocking the option to discuss his family and learn about the armor. This can also be acquired by stumbling upon it, but talking to Wrex is the more natural and intuitive way to initiate the assignment.
Understanding Wrex and the Armor Quest
Introduction to Wrex
The Wrex family armor quest is a significant part of the Mass Effect storyline, especially for those interested in Urdnot Wrex’s character development and backstory. Wrex is a Krogan warrior who joins Commander Shepard’s squad, bringing his unique combat skills and perspectives to the team.

Where is Wrex in CSEC Academy? Wrex can be found surrounded by C-Sec guards to the side of the central elevator in the C-Sec Academy, where a conversation with him will lead to him joining your squad.

Can you equip Wrex family armor? The Wrex family armor is a plot item and cannot be equipped by Shepard or any other character; it’s primarily a storyline element.

Who replaced Wrex in Mass Effect 2? If Wrex is killed, his role in Mass Effect 2 is replaced by his broodbrother, Urdnot Wreav.
